Hi all — welcoming Mara Teslin as incoming director. Mara, quick context: the Orvale plant is maxed out, and we're deciding between a third shift or expanding the Quillbrook site. Numbers land Friday; we'd like your read before the board call. The background and our current leaning are laid out in the note below.

internal memo for kawip-hadug: Headcount on the Wenwyn team goes from 7 to 140 by the end of January. Gross margin on Wenwyn came in at 20 percent against a plan of 15 percent.

Reviewers of the Ostermark ORM refactor: changes must keep the legacy query builder callable until phase three, so reject any PR that deletes adapter shims early. Verify each migrated model has a parity test comparing old and new query output row-for-row. Migration order and the per-model status tracker are maintained here.

operations page: https://confluence.qorvellabs.internal/pages/projects/projects/projects

## Tuning the `tailmint` CLI

The tailmint CLI streams logs from the Oakhollow aggregation tier. New team members should understand that it applies client-side buffering and rate limiting to avoid overwhelming both your terminal and the upstream fanout nodes. If you see dropped lines, your follow rate exceeds the buffer drain rate; widen the buffer before raising the rate cap, since the cap protects shared infrastructure. All knobs live in your user config and take effect on the next invocation. The shipped defaults are listed below.

constants for bawep-fajog:
RATE_LIMITS = {
    "oliath": 2,
    "wenix": 5,
    "quenael": 5,
    "ralix": 2,
}